全国服务热线
服务热线
当前位置: 首页 >
可重复读会使乐观锁进入无限自旋中,原因是select语句查询到一直是mvcc一致性读视图,这个数据是不会更新的,导致cas中的查询环节失效,以至于更新一直失败。
解决办法:1、事务外循环,每次cas都重开事务。
2、事务内循环,cas的查询语句加for update,因为加了锁所以性能很差。
3、降低事务隔离级别为读已提交,导致一致性视图失效。
4、最推荐的,没有事务就是最好的事务,对于多个源频繁修改同一条数据某个字段的情况,应该考虑…。
有没有免费的云服务器?
Postgres 和 MySQL 应该怎么选?
有什么草/植物,只要很浅的盆土就能长很高?
如何看待机器之心重测高考数学全卷,Gemini夺冠,豆包DeepSeek并列第二?
闲鱼上为什么会有人问都不问直接下单?
为什么不用rust重写Nginx?
长期使用的大佬来说说,MacOS 真的比 Windows 稳定吗?
为什么网站要部署ssl证书?
QQ咨询
联系电话
微信扫一扫
返回顶部